The Advantages of Cloud Computing
In the situation of business software applications, the existing implementations have in most cases been very complex and overpriced. They require a business in Alpena to invest deeply on capital expenditure to build an in-house data center with offices, environmental controls, electrical power, dedicated servers, storage arrays, and network bandwidth. In addition to all this costly infrastructure is the need for a complex software stack for the program. Even after the software has been implemented, you will also need a group of experts to set up, manage, and execute the software. But this was before the advent of cloud computing.
A simple example of cloud computing is email supplied with no software set up from suppliers such as Microsoft's Hotmail or Google's Gmail. You don't need to install any software or buy a dedicated server in order to utilize them. All a business requires is simply an internet connection so the users can start sending emails. The server and email administration software is all on the cloud and is totally managed by the cloud service supplier such as Microsoft, Yahoo, or Google. The user gets the use of the software and experience the advantages.
Businesses in Alpena are managing all sorts of programs in the cloud these days, such as customer relationship management, human resources, bookkeeping, and other custom applications. Cloud-based applications can be up and running in a few days, which is unusual with common business software. They are less expensive, due to the fact you don't need to make payment for all the people, products, and facilities to run them. And, it seems they're more scalable, more secure, and more reliable than most programs. Plus, upgrades are taken care of for you, so your apps get security and speed improvements and new features automagically.
